Overview

Porty Festival is a dynamic annual celebration of arts, music, and community in the vibrant coastal suburb of Portobello, Edinburgh, since its launch in 2018, transforming the High Street into a bustling hub of creativity, live performances, and family-friendly fun that captures the town’s seaside spirit and artistic heritage. Organized by a passionate local team with support from Edinburgh City Council and sponsors like Portobello BID, it blends genres from folk and jazz to indie rock, comedy, theatre, and visual arts, drawing thousands for a weekend of open-air concerts, street theatre, workshops, and markets that spotlight emerging Scottish talents alongside international acts. As a not-for-profit event, it emphasizes inclusivity with affordable or free entry to most activities, fostering a joyful, accessible escape where attendees can wander from seaside gigs to craft stalls, all while boosting the local economy and cultural scene in this historic “Edinburgh’s seaside town,” known for its sandy beaches and Victorian architecture.

For 2026, the festival is set to return with its signature late-August timing, promising an expanded program of music stages, interactive arts sessions, and community events that open on Friday evening with a seaside concert, building to a full-day Saturday extravaganza, and closing Sunday with family-focused fun. About this Event

  • Founded in 2018 to revive Portobello’s artistic scene post-Brexit and pandemic, organized by local enthusiasts with Edinburgh City Council backing.
  • Focuses on a mix of music, theatre, and visual arts, attracting 3,000+ annually with a blend of free and ticketed events.
  • Held in Portobello High Street and beach, leveraging the town’s seaside heritage for open-air intimacy.
  • Not-for-profit, with ties to Portobello BID for economic boost, providing platforms for Scottish emerging artists.
  • Emphasizes family inclusivity with affordable pricing and open-air accessibility, fostering intergenerational participation.
  • Evolving with new elements like beach cinema, blending tradition with innovation in Edinburgh’s coastal suburb.

Getting There

  • Nearest airports: Edinburgh Airport (EDI), 10 miles away (20-minute drive via A1); Glasgow Airport (GLA) for more flights, about 50 miles (1-hour drive or train).
  • Public transport: Trains from London Kings Cross to Portobello station (4 hours via LNER with change at Edinburgh); local buses connect station to High Street (5-minute ride).
  • Driving: Access via A1 coastal road, with free parking at Portobello Promenade; SatNav postcode EH15 2AH.
  • Cycling/walking: Portobello’s promenade is bike-friendly; racks at High Street; station to venue 10-minute walk.
  • Accessibility: Wheelchair-friendly promenade with ramps; taxis from station ($10 via apps); contact for priority parking.
